Course Description
Course information provided by the 2018-2019 Catalog.
The course in advanced biomaterials leads the class through the process of material design and characterization for their development as products in the medical device or pharmaceutical fields. Student teams will apply their fundamental knowledge of chemistry and biology to open-ended design challenges focused on biomaterial mechanics, processability, biocompatibility and federal regulatory requirements. Hands-on technical work in materials characterization will be combined with key knowledge of biomaterials to give the class an integrated understanding of biomaterials design and development. Specific topics to be covered are classes of biomaterials, methods of characterization, the interface of biomaterials and biology, the foreign body response, inflammation, wound healing, biofilms, sterilization methods, FDA-approval guidelines and EU-approval guidelines.
